Output aabeb1dd14e908419058dcf527c9d63ad31a456051021492f29208ee9b1fd226: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cfe3a710502217b2f4963fc37ec8e5341e4107a OP_EQUAL
address
37FX29Log4TV6NXpwAhuWshbR2vMQXSUex
transaction
aabeb1dd14e908419058dcf527c9d63ad31a456051021492f29208ee9b1fd226
spent
true